About The Position

Department of Synthetic Molecule Pharmaceutics (SMP) is part of the Synthetic Molecule Pharmaceutical Sciences (SMPS) organization. Our department is committed to developing and delivering safe, effective and high-quality formulations in support of research and clinical development for the synthetic molecules coming out of gRED. Our research spans from fundamental understanding of physicochemical properties of molecules to drug delivery technologies needed for the development and manufacturing of dosage forms. This internship position is located in South San Francisco, on-site. The Opportunity Engineered and characterized novel nanoparticle (NP) formulations for targeted drug delivery. Designed and executed a comprehensive nanoparticle platform, optimizing for enhanced targeted delivery efficacy. Developed and implemented novel analytical methodologies to evaluate and ensure high-level performance of lipid nanoparticle (LNP) systems. Conducted rigorous data analysis, precisely measuring key metrics including particle size, entrapment efficiency (EE%), and target density. Communicated and presented research findings and technical recommendations to cross-functional teams, facilitating platform development.
